Yue Jiang felt dizzy and her whole body ached. Her tongue was filled with the taste of fish and rust. She was on the verge of waking up but could not. In her hazy mind, she recalled what had happened.
Feng, which was on good terms with An, was destroyed by Jing. Yue Jiang's marriage procession had to pass through Feng, but when Feng was attacked by Jing, An did not send any troops to support it.
To avoid trouble, Yue Jiang's team took a detour around a mountain and continued onward, only to encounter the fleeing army of Feng State, followed by the people of Jing State.
She was probably captured and taken to the Jing Kingdom's camp.
Suddenly, Yue Jiang heard a conversation and listened intently.
Wei You: "Your Highness, you are right. When we attack the Feng clan, Anguo will not be willing to waste its military strength to send troops to rescue them. The fleeing troops will be difficult to pursue and suppress, and the fleeing Feng clan troops will definitely try to save themselves."
"The only target they can get their eyes on is the Yue Kingdom princess, who is also the Crown Princess of An Kingdom. This way, the mob will take the opportunity to abduct the Yue Kingdom's marriage procession."
"We can also wipe out this group in one fell swoop. Now the Feng family's deserters have all been eliminated."
Yuejiang: The mantis stalks the cicada, unaware of the oriole behind!
"How is the situation in the Moon Kingdom?" Immediately, a voice that Yue Jiang had heard not long ago asked.
Yue Jiang silently deduced that this was Jing Kingdom territory, and someone had just addressed her as "Your Highness."
Could he be Jing Yan, the Crown Prince of Jing Kingdom?
Wei You continued his report: "The Yue Kingdom is incredibly generous. This marriage alliance with the An Kingdom alone has included a dowry of one million taels of gold, two million taels of silver, ten thousand bolts of silk and satin, a thousand chests of pearls and agates, and a hundred cartloads of ironware..."
"The entire marriage procession numbered over ten thousand people. As you said, even though the Yue Kingdom is wealthy, this marriage has far exceeded the usual practice."
"Your Highness, what should be done?" he asked after reporting in a formal and methodical manner.
Jing Yan's cold and aloof voice rang out, tinged with hatred.
“Anguo is treacherous and shameless. It should have paid off its debt to Jingguo long ago. Since it is a gift from the marriage alliance with Anguo, it naturally belongs to Jingguo.”
To reminisce about the past grievances between the states of Jing and An, we must begin with the grandfather of Jingyan, who was also the grandfather of An Chenghuan, the crown prince of An.
The grandfathers of Jing and An were once hostages in the Kingdom of Yu when they were young. During their time as hostages, they formed a friendship like that of half-brothers. After returning to their respective countries, they often visited each other's countries.
When An Chenghuan's grandfather ascended the throne, Jingyan's grandfather was invited to Anguo to offer his congratulations, but little did he know that this trip would lead to trouble.
Under the guise of his own grand ascension to the throne, An Chenghuan's grandfather led his men to strangle Jingyan's grandfather's attendants and then poisoned Jingyan's grandfather at the banquet.
The ruler of Jing was detained by Anguo, who then imposed arbitrary treaties on Jing, causing chaos in the Jing court and forcing the imposition of many shameful regulations.
Even the Feng Kingdom, which rose to prominence forty years ago, was established because of internal turmoil in the Jing Kingdom. The imperial court ordered Fengzhou to raise troops to attack the An Kingdom, and the general of Fengzhou, lured by An Kingdom, rebelled against the Jing Kingdom and established his own state.
Jingyan's grandfather, ashamed of his gullibility in trusting a villain, which had brought disaster upon his family and country, committed suicide by crashing into a pillar in the Anguo court while Jingguo was raising a huge ransom to send to Anguo.
Even after Jingyan's grandfather died, Anguo's exploitation of Jingguo had not stopped.
Because the rise of Feng State was aided by An State, the ruler of Feng State advised An State to demote Jing Yan's father, who had already ascended the throne, to a vassal state and make Jing State's territory a vassal state of An State.
Jingyan's grandfather died after hitting a pillar, but he continued to humiliate the new king, the Marquis Jiang.
Jingguo would rather fight to the death with all the strength of the nation than suffer this humiliation again, and only agreed to send one million taels of silver to Anguo every year to settle the matter.
For the sake of this million taels of silver, the people within the Jing Kingdom lived a life of unbearable suffering.
While paying money to the enemy with hatred in their hearts, they secretly and diligently trained their soldiers, and finally launched a counterattack last year.
Led by Jing Yan, the army was dispatched to attack Feng Guo, who was an internal traitor to Jing Guo and a lackey of An Guo.
In half a year, they destroyed the Feng Kingdom, giving the An Kingdom a severe warning.
Upon receiving the reply, Wei You, filled with indignation, agreed: "Your Highness is right!"
Yue Jiang: "..."
"What does Your Highness intend to do with the Moon Kingdom princess and her entourage?" Wei You asked again.
Yue Jiang's heartstrings tightened.
Jing Yan remained silent for a long time, but the sound of rushing water could be heard.
Just then, the throbbing pain in Yue Jiang's head subsided, and a glimmer of light finally appeared in her eyes.
She could vaguely see a tall, imposing man sitting in front of the bed to the side. The man's clothes had been stripped down to only his plain undershirt and trousers, and he was clutching a handkerchief in his hand.
He wrung out a handkerchief and placed it over the web of his right hand, giving Yue Jiang a sharp, focused look.
Fortunately, Yue Jiang was alert and immediately closed her half-open eyes. She didn't know if Jing Yan had noticed that she was awake, and she felt uncomfortable staying in one position.
Just as Yue Jiang could no longer maintain her pretense, Jing Yan's calm voice rang out from beside her bed.
"Over the years, Yue Kingdom has donated a lot of gold and silver treasures to the six kingdoms for the sake of peace in the region. Jing Kingdom has also benefited a lot. Otherwise, Jing Kingdom would not have recovered its strength so quickly. Logically, I should not make things difficult for Yue Kingdom."
Yuejiang: Not bad! You actually have a conscience!
“However…” Jing Yan’s tone shifted, his voice becoming even deeper: “Although the Yue Kingdom is neutral and does not participate in the conflicts, it does not mean that it cannot pose a threat to the Jing Kingdom.”
"Otherwise, why would the King of Yue dare to send so many things to An Kingdom under the guise of a marriage alliance? He must have some ulterior motive."
Yue Jiang wanted to cry but had no tears, and trembled with fear.
The Moon Kingdom was neither strong nor brave. In the beginning, it was only the size of a single state called Moon State. Its only redeeming quality was its abundance of mines and wealth, and the fact that its people knew how to make money.
Over the past three hundred years, the five neighboring countries of Jing, An, Yu, Chen, and Qi have maintained close ties and become familiar with each other.
Gradually, Yuezhou gained considerable prestige among the various countries, and with their support, it established itself as a separate nation, thus dividing the world into six parts.
After that, regardless of the various disturbances from other countries, none of them took action against the Moon Kingdom.
It was definitely not because the Yue Kingdom later became militarily strong; on the contrary, apart from being good at making money and having both men and women who were beautiful, the people of the Yue Kingdom were useless at everything else.
The reason why the Moon Kingdom has stood firm to this day is entirely because it can serve as a money bag for the six kingdoms.
If there's a money bag placed in front of everyone for them to take as they please, who would tolerate letting someone else have it all to themselves?
If anyone dares to monopolize it, the others will unite and beat them up until they ask, "Do you even know the rules?"
So weak, who would they dare to conspire with?
In the past, when the Yue Kingdom made peace with other countries through marriage, it would only pay an exorbitant price to obtain a royal concubine, a royal wife, or a royal concubine.
Just then, Anguo sent an olive branch for a marriage alliance, offering her the position of Crown Princess. How could Yueguo refuse?
Jing State, however, was bullied by An State and remained dormant for forty years, yet it surprisingly managed to destroy Feng State in just six months.
Perhaps Anguo foresaw Jingguo's vengeance and was urgently seeking allies. Coincidentally, Yueguo was wealthy, so Yueguo must have been outmaneuvered by Anguo!
Yue Jiangren was implicated before she even married into Anguo. She opened her eyes, cursing inwardly.
In order to survive, Yue Jiang brainstormed and came up with an idea.
Jing Yan, having finished his thought, said, "The Yue Kingdom needs to be taught a lesson. We should use the Yue Kingdom princess and her entourage as..."
Yue Jiang spotted Jing Yan's location, mustered her courage, and clumsily hunched over to move to the bedside of the man who had kidnapped her.
Just as Jing Yan was about to make a decision, a soft voice came from beside his feet.
"Husband, my hand hurts!"
